This paper mainly deals with the uncertainly multi-attribute decision-making problem based on preference information.It consists of four chapters.In the first chapter,we mainly introduce the development and current research situation of the uncertainly multi-attribute decision-making problem.Furthermore, we list the main contribution of this paper.In the second chapter,the multi-attribute decision-making problems is investigated, in which the information about attribute weights is partly known and the attribute values take the form of uncertain linguistic variables,and the decision maker has preferences on alternatives.Based on the deviation degree of linguistic variables,a simple linear programming model is established,from which the attribute weights can be derived.Then,a method for multi-attribute decision-making with linguistic information is proposed on the distance measures of the uncertainly linguistic variables and the linguistic ideal solutions.Finally, the implementation process of the proposed method is illustrated and analyzed by a numerical example.In the third chapter,A goal programming method is proposed to obtain normalized interval weights vectors from an interval number complementary judgement matrix.It is applicable to any crisp and interval comparison matrix no matter whether they are consistent or not.Comparisons with an interval regression analysis method are also made.Then,the approach is generalized to the triangular fuzzy number matrix.Based on this theory,a group decision-making method is induced.Finally,numerical examples are given to show the effectiveness of the method.In the forth chapter,approaches to multi-attribute decision-making with intuitionistic fuzzy preference information are studied.First,the multi-attribute group decision-making problem is investigated,where the attribute values are given as real numbers and the preference information on attributes take the form of intuitionistic judgment matrix and incomplete intuitionistic judgment matrix. Second,a method is presented to deal with the multi-attribute decision-making problem with preference values on alternatives,in which the attribute weights were completely unkonwn and the attribute values were given in the form of intuitionistic fuzzy numbers.A fuzzy expected value goal programming model was constructed to derive the attribute weights.Then,the utility values of alternatives were obtained based on additive weighting average,and ranking alternatives were determined by using the expected value method of ranking fuzzy variables. Finally,illustrative examples are also given respectively.
